netbeans java程序打包 无法运行

在mac里安装了netbeans,写了一个简单的程序,运行下来没有任何问题。构建成的jar却无法运行。具体是点了之后什么反应也没有。然后那这个程序到win8上去运行,同样... 在mac里安装了netbeans,写了一个简单的程序,运行下来没有任何问题。构建成的jar却无法运行。具体是点了之后什么反应也没有。然后那这个程序到win8上去运行,同样没有任何反应。win8上jkd环境已安装
求助!谢谢!
展开
 我来答
若以下回答无法解决问题,邀请你更新回答
alexmao4
2014-08-08 · TA获得超过1741个赞
知道大有可为答主
回答量:2350
采纳率:50%
帮助的人:481万
展开全部
你是说双击jar包能运行吗?
如果是,你需要指明main函数是哪个。
也就是给jar包加上?META-INF/mainfest
Main-class: xxxx
追问
你好。
不好意思我是java新手,所以说的话有些可能相当不专业
双击以外,右键打开也不行。
指明main函数具体是怎么操作?
给jar包加上那个语句是怎么加?加在程序里吗?程序的那个位置?还有那个Main-class: xxxx的xxxx是模糊的说法吗?还是就是xxxx加进去就可以了?
追答
我现在没时间给你在nb中具体操作,我习惯用eclipse。你自己去百度搜索下“netbeans 可执行 jar”,应该有结果。
mainfest是你的jar包清单,在每个jar中都存在,具体是一些元信息,比如,厂商,日期等。
你用winrar或者7zip打开jar包,都能看到META-INF下的 MANIFEST.MF文件。

xxx是模糊的说法,如果你包含main的类是com.abc.ClassA.
那么你写上即可。请给分,谢谢
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式